Amazon Web Services (AWS) has announced a strategic expansion in its software development toolkit by allowing the integration of Superblocks, a startup specializing in 'vibe-coding,' directly into customer private cloud environments. This move represents a significant evolution in how enterprise applications are built and managed, specifically focusing on the portability and flexibility of software architectures.

By embedding Superblocks within AWS private clouds, organizations can now utilize advanced development tools while maintaining data residency and strict security controls. According to TechCrunch, this development is a critical step toward decoupling application logic from specific underlying machine learning models. This separation allows developers to swap out or upgrade AI models without necessitating a complete overhaul of the user-facing application architecture.

The integration addresses a growing demand in the enterprise sector for modular AI development. As businesses look to leverage generative AI without becoming tethered to a single proprietary model provider, the capability to build atop a vendor-agnostic layer becomes increasingly valuable. By facilitating this bridge through its cloud infrastructure, AWS is positioning itself to support more resilient and adaptable software ecosystems for its enterprise clients.
